From Vancouver British Columbia, stayed here with 5 grandchildren. We felt management was very accommodating. Our site local wasn't great being 10 feet from office and laundry room. The smell from the dryers was a little overwhelming day after day being so close, however the rest of the park made up for that. It is a bit tight, with no privacy between sites, but then again the views were amazing, the grounds well manicured, the dog area fantastic and proximity to Portland great! . The beach is great for driftwood and shells. The beach firepits had wood provided as well as chairs for ship watching. The pool, laundry room, showers were spotless. Very refreshing. Every aspect of this park was well thought out. A word of caution, the beach has an abundance of broken glass. We suggest shoes for everyone!

Stayed here while visiting relatives in Vancouver, WA. Sites are close together, with no privacy between sites. Toilets and showers were very clean, laundry area lined the same. WiFi was very good. This was not a "campground", more like an RV parking lot. But it worked well for a base for visiting and touring in the area. I found the ladies in the office to be helpful when making my reservation and efficient when checking in. Our site had a good view of the Columbia River. My only negative relates to the sewer connection. It was at the rear of the site, required an extension, and was just a few inches lower than the trailer outlet. Not convenient, but workable.

The park itself was not bad at all. Gorgeous views of the Columbia River! A large pet walk area. Big rig friendly. The electric poles are shared however so whichever neighbor arrives first has their choice of 50amp or 30amp. We couldn't reach our sewer without pulling into the road. The ladies in the office were very rude on the phone and not much better in person. I'm not sure that I would stay here again. It was expensive and not really worth what we got for the price. But I must add that the Walmart is really close and it was THE nicest Walmart I've ever been to!

This is a beautiful park and a Top 100 park from Good Sam. While it is quite beautiful and right on the river, the rules and office staff are a little off-putting. From the very first phone call to make the reservation to the check in and out, the office staff was quite curt and short, just short of rude.
I can see why this park gets good rates as the amenities and grounds are outstanding. The grass is lush and full and heavily watered even in an extreme drought. The beachfront access and beach is amazing. However, behold the RULES!
The rules are HEAVILY enforced when making the reservation on the phone and even more so in person. While I don't have too much problem with the rules, as we always abide by them, the way they are enforced seems a little excessive. They do not mince any words and go over them with a fine tooth comb - all 2 pages of fine print!
She stated that if you even park a tiny hair over the grass line they will make you move and don't even think about your dog barking - even once. They strictly say barking dogs are not allowed on-line and in their printed rules. Now, when do dogs not bark? We don't allow ours to bark more than just a first few barks of hello because we don't like it either but how can you stop them from completely barking? They also do not state anywhere on line or any of their literature, but they charge $2 a day for 3 dogs or more.
Also, they repeatedly state that dogs cannot be off leash and the leash must be in your hands at all times. HOWEVER, that must not apply to the people who work here as we repeatedly saw someone driving a golf cart on the grass with two dogs in the cart. This person would throw a tennis ball ahead of the cart about 25 feet and then the dogs would jump out and run after the ball, get back in the cart and start over again.
Rates include up to 4 people. If you have 5 or 6 or any visitors, they are charged a daily use fee. Also, you are only allowed 6 people at any one RV, including registered guests and visitors, including children. I feel sorry for large families who are not allowed to stay here. They also charge for extra vehicles. I do not like places that nickel and dime you to death.
The noise is non-existent except for the ships passing by and this is in beautiful farmland so there isn't any other noise.
Wifi is marginal as it would always die and lock up for extended periods. AT&T Cellular had 4 bars.
This park would be a 5 if they had nice, courteous, welcoming staff and loosened up a bit.
